XRP operates within the digital asset sector, offering solutions for cross-border transactions. Ripple, the company behind XRP, focuses on enabling faster and more cost-effective financial exchanges across global markets. As an alternative to traditional payment methods, XRP plays a crucial role in the facilitation of secure, scalable, and real-time transactions between financial institutions.

Rising Adoption and Global Integration

The value of XRP has been positively impacted by its growing adoption in various international markets. By serving as a bridge currency, XRP is utilized for transferring value between different currencies in a seamless and efficient manner. Ripple’s network is increasingly integrated into the global financial ecosystem, supporting its ability to handle diverse real-world financial scenarios.
